EMPIRE PARLIAMENTARY TOUR

MEMBERS AT SUVA SUVA, August 22. ,The British Parliamentary party was entertained by the Chamber of Commerce. (From Our Own Correspondent.) WELLINGTON, August 22. Owing to the delay in the arrival of the British Parliamentary party at Auckland through the Makura Being behind her time, the Hon. H. D. Bell (Minister of Internal Affairs) will not proceed to Auckland to-morrow as he had intended. He may leave on Monday, but he has not yet decided that pointy as more definite information as to the time of the steamer's arrival is being awaited.
